How this process is pc term … WebShifting your perspective can help you reframe how you think and speak about people with mental illnesses and similar stigmatized subjects. 4. Don’t use: “Schizophrenic, psychotic, disturbed, crazy or insane”. Instead, use: “Person living with schizophrenia”; “Person experiencing psychosis, disorientation or hallucination”.

And the reason we selected [it] was because nobody … brown spots on lamp shadesWebNot all members of the disability community think person-first language is the best choice. Some writers and scholars from the field known as disability studies, as well as advocates and activists from disability culture, prefer what is known as identity-first language for disability.
